This chapter presents the author's recommendations which are based on the review of the literature in Part 1, and the findings from the study presented in Part 2. The recommendations are also informed by the findings from the evaluation of the workshops held in collaboration with European Network for Academic Integrity. These recommendations include: a regional and national approach to academic integrity; an academic integrity inventory for all institutions; formalizing the structures for academic integrity within each institution; the creation of academic integrity and GenAI policies for all institutions; and education in both academic integrity and AI. The recommendations also present the need to revise assessment practices and engage in a targeted approach to the development of critical thinking skills. These recommendations, if adopted, should create the context in which students learn to use GenAI tools responsibly in alignment with policy guidelines and faculty instructions, so that academic integrity is not compromised.
